MayaMan Installation

MayaMan can be more complex than other programs to install and get running correctly, because of its task of making two separate programs interface with each other. This page outlines how to get MayaMan correctly installed, what the installation program does when it is run, and how to manually setup MayaMan if necessary.

Setting up your RenderMan Renderers

You should ensure that your RenderMan renders are installed correctly before running the MayaMan installer. For more guidance on this see the page on verifying your RenderMan setup.

Installing MayaMan for Windows

After downloading the latest MayaMan release from the Animal Logic Web Site you should unzip it and run the installation program. This installer will copy all the necessary MayaMan files to the location you specify, and configure Maya to look for the plugin. You will be asked for the location of various programs during the installation process. The installer will also set some environment settings, so that the MayaMan plugin will know where to find its shaders and other support files.

Installing MayaMan for IRIX/Linux

To get MayaMan running under Unix, you need to download and unzip the MayaMan archive, then set the following environment variables correctly before running Maya:

When you unzip the MayaMan archive, you will find a mayaman.env file, which you can modify with the correct paths, and source this file before running Maya (for convenience, have it sourced as part of your normal shell environment).

Also, if you are using Pixar's PRMan, and find that it fails to find the 'soft' display driver (used by MayaMan by default) you will need to update $RMANTREE/etc/rendermn.ini to contain the following line:

There is a bug in at least some versions of PRMan that prevents it from finding the display driver based on the search paths that MayaMan puts in the RIB files.
